22 East Crescent St, Mcmahons Point is a 4 bedroom, 3 bathroom House with 3 parking spaces and was built in 1918. The property has a land size of 474m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in October 2015.

The size of Mcmahons Point is approximately 0.4 square kilometres. It has 9 parks covering nearly 12.5% of total area. The population of Mcmahons Point in 2011 was 2,344 people. By 2016 the population was 2,284 showing a population decline of 2.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Mcmahons Point is 30-39 years. Households in Mcmahons Point are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Mcmahons Point work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 45.8% of the homes in Mcmahons Point were owner-occupied compared with 45.7% in 2016.
